The Agricultural Revolution was a pivotal moment in human history. It began around 10,000 BC and marked the transition from hunting and gathering to farming. Early humans learned to cultivate crops, domesticate animals, and settle in one place. This transformation not only allowed for more reliable food sources but also laid the foundation for the rise of civilizations.
The inventions and innovations that emerged during this time, such as the plow, irrigation systems, and crop rotation, helped people increase their food production and sustain growing populations. Over time, farming became more efficient, allowing societies to flourish. The creation of permanent settlements led to the development of trade, technology, and social structures—key elements in the rise of early civilizations and modern society.

4. The Connection Between Agriculture and Society
The Agricultural Revolution not only changed how people farmed but also reshaped social structures. It led to the rise of permanent settlements and the formation of societies, creating the foundation for the development of cities, trade, and industry. The ability to grow and store surplus food was a game-changer, allowing for the specialization of labor. People didn’t have to focus solely on growing food; they could take on other roles like trading, crafting, and governing, leading to the rise of civilizations.
Understanding this connection helps kids realize that agriculture is not just about planting crops and raising animals—it’s about shaping the world we live in. The way we produce food affects every aspect of society, from economics and politics to culture and the environment in the U.S. and in foreign countries across the globe.
